Exploring the Terroirs of Champagne, France
Champagne, renowned for its effervescent sparkling wines, is much more than just a exquisite beverage. It is a region defined by its varied terroirs – the specific physical factors that influence the profile of the grapes grown there. From the chalky soils of the Montagne de Reims to the clay-rich valleys of the Vallée de la Marne, each terroir imparts individual nuances to the wines produced.
Embark on a sensory exploration through Champagne's distinct terroirs and uncover the complexities that make this region so captivating.
* Start in the Montagne de Reims, known for its high-altitude vineyards with predominantly chalky soils. Wines from this area are often powerful, with complex aromas of citrus.
* Then venture to the Côte des Blancs, famous for its Chardonnay grapes grown on a particular blend of clay and limestone soils. These wines are bright, with notes of white flower and a delicate minerality.
* Finally, explore the Vallée de la Marne, characterized by its rolling landscape and fertile clay-rich soils. Wines from this area are often lighter, with zesty fruit flavors and a pleasing finish.

Journey Through the Champagne Winemaking Process in France
Embark on a delightful journey through the heart of France's champagne region. Here, amidst rolling vineyards and charming villages, lies the art of transforming humble grapes into the world-renowned sparkling wine. The process begins with meticulous harvesting of ripe Chardonnay, Pinot Noir, and Pinot Meunier grapes. These cherished fruits are then extracted to yield a golden juice, which undergoes a first fermentation in large tanks.

The wine is then mixed to achieve the desired flavor profile, and bottled for its second fermentation. This crucial step occurs in each bottle, where yeast consumes the remaining sugar, producing those characteristic fizzes that define champagne. Finally, the bottles are riddled to collect the sediment and then sealed. The result is a wine that embodies the tradition of Champagne, ready to be enjoyed on exceptional occasions.
